New Mitsubishi Outlander production begins

New Mitsubishi Outlander production begins

Posted on February 9, 2021August 27, 2023 By Jarvis

Fourth-generation mid-size SUV confirmed for Australia this year as world debut a week away

The 2021 Mitsubishi Outlander has entered production in Japan a week before its world debut and its Australian release later this year.

The news was announced overnight, alongside what appears to be an Amazon promotion – despite the fact the global e-commerce giant doesn’t deliver cars – in the form of a large box being delivered to the US.
